PAUL J. MASELLI

Paul J. Maselli

Paul J. Maselli, co-founding partner of Maselli Warren, P.C., has more than 18 years experience representing commercial leaders and financial institutions in commercial lending, loan work out, state court litigation and bankruptcy matters. In addition, he has provided substantial representation to financially-stressed businesses and consumers in out of court work outs and dissolutions as well as in bankruptcy proceedings.

Since 1998, his practice expanded to the representation of start ups and established small and medium-sized businesses, helping them with transactions, banking and financing, tax, litigation and employee benefits. He continues to work for financial institutions and his relationships with banks and lenders often benefit his business clients.

As a frequent lecturer for continuing legal education, Mr. Maselli teaches other attorneys how to better represent their clients. He has served on several seminar panels sponsored by prestigious organizations including the New Jersey State Bar Association, the American Bar Association and the New Jersey Society of Certified Public Accountants. His published articles have appeared in The Commercial Law Journal, The New Jersey Law Journal and other legal and business periodicals.

Mr. Maselli participates as a member on the boards of several charitable and community organizations. He resides with his family in Cranbury, New Jersey. Mr. Maselli is a graduate of Clark University with a Bachelor of Arts degree in English and in Psychology. He earned his Juris Doctorate degree from Rutgers University School of Law - Camden in 1986. He also has a Certificate of Admission for the United States District Court for the Eastern District of Michigan.
